As my speedo stopped working a while ago I finally got round to dropping the exhaust so i could remove the sensor/drive.

With a meter i could find no continuity or output from the sensor at all. On the car wiring side I found +12v and a 0.3v signal when the ignition is on. Spinning the drive with a drill with the ignition on, connected to the car produced no reaction from the speedo - i think the drive/sensor is duff.

The drive cog of the sensor is orange and has 20 teeth, Rimmer have something listed but not sure if they have stock. Anyone know of any other sources ?

Having pulled the sensor from my car it was unclear if mine was 4 pulse or 8 pulse, so I dismantled it, and from the internals it looks like 4 pulse.

In doing so, i discovered lack of continuity in the yellow wire to the PCB, so i repaired this and araldited up the cable entry/exit point and will test it on the car tonight once it has all set fully.

I saw a post elsewhere with a similar fix effected without full dismantle, seems like a commonish problem area.
